Lightweight Cellular Concrete – Cell-Crete Corporation
Product Details: Lightweight Cellular Concrete (LCC) is a construction material made from type (I) II‐V Portland cement, water, and preformed foam, which creates air voids to reduce density.
Technical Parameters:
– Cast density as low as 24 PCF (pounds per cubic foot)
– Production capacity of upwards of 2000 CY/day per portable batch plant
Application Scenarios:
– Lightweight backfill in subsurface structures
– Flowable fill material in construction projects
Pros:
– Reduces earth pressure and minimizes dynamic forces
– Significant savings in time and cost compared to traditional ground improvement…
Cons:
– Limited understanding of engineering properties in some applications
– Potential variability in performance based on foam quantity and mixing

What is lightweight concrete, and why is it used?
Lightweight concrete is a type of concrete that incorporates lightweight aggregates, making it lighter than traditional concrete. It’s commonly used in construction for its reduced weight, which can lower structural loads and improve insulation. This makes it ideal for projects like high-rise buildings, precast panels, and other applications where weight savings are crucial.

What are the benefits of using lightweight concrete?
Lightweight concrete offers several advantages, including reduced dead load on structures, improved thermal insulation, and enhanced workability. It can also lead to lower transportation costs due to its lighter weight and can help speed up construction timelines. Overall, it’s a versatile choice for many building projects.
Can lightweight concrete be used for outdoor applications?
Yes, lightweight concrete can be used for outdoor applications, but it’s important to ensure it’s properly formulated for durability. Look for products that are designed to withstand weather conditions and potential freeze-thaw cycles. Consulting with your supplier can help you choose the right mix for outdoor use.
